## helper function that stabilizes the negative gradient if requested by the user
stabilize_ngradient <- function(ngr, w = 1, stabilization) {
    ## set which to MAD if gamboostLSS_stab_ngrad = TRUE and which == "none"
    if (stabilization == "none" && getOption("gamboostLSS_stab_ngrad"))
        stabilization <- "MAD"
    ## stabilization using the mean absolute deviation (MAD)
    if (stabilization == "MAD") {
        div <- weighted.median(abs(ngr - weighted.median(ngr, w = w, na.rm = TRUE)),
                               w = w, na.rm = TRUE)
        div <- ifelse(div < 0.0001, 0.0001, div)
        ngr <- ngr / div
    }
    ngr
}


check_stabilization <- function(stabilization = c("none", "MAD")) {
    stabilization <- match.arg(stabilization)
    ## check if old stabilization interface is used and issue a warning
    if (getOption("gamboostLSS_stab_ngrad")) {
        warning("Usage of ", sQuote("options(gamboostLSS_stab_ngrad = TRUE)"),
                " is deprecated.\n", "Use argument ", sQuote("stabilization"),
                " in the fitting family. See ?Families for details.")
        if (stabilization == "none")
           warning(sQuote("stabilization"), " is set to ", dQuote("MAD"))
    }
    stabilization
}
